Cost of Underground Spout Cleaning

Underground spout cleaning involves removing debris, buildup, and obstructions from the piping system that directs water from rain gutters or other sources. The cost for this service can vary depending on the size and complexity of the system, the type of materials used, and the specific site conditions. Factors such as accessibility and the extent of cleaning required may also influence the final price.

Pricing for underground spout cleaning typically ranges based on project scope, materials involved, labor requirements, and site-specific challenges. It is common for costs to differ between projects, so obtaining detailed estimates can help compare options effectively. Final pricing should be discussed with service providers after evaluating the particular needs of the system and site conditions.

Factors Affecting Cost

Underground spout cleaning involves the removal of debris, sediment, and buildup from underground drainage or irrigation spouts. Proper cleaning helps maintain efficient water flow and prevents clogging issues that can lead to property damage or drainage problems.

  • Materials: Typically involves specialized cleaning tools, brushes, and high-pressure water equipment designed for underground systems.
  • Size and Scope: Can range from small, localized spouts to extensive underground drainage networks, affecting overall project complexity.
  • Labor Complexity: Varies based on accessibility, system depth, and extent of buildup, influencing the level of effort required.
  • Permitting: Usually requires adherence to local regulations; permits may be needed for certain underground work or system modifications.
  • Extras: Additional services may include system inspection, minor repairs, or installation of new components to improve drainage performance.
